1 O Lord, send forth the Lamb, the Ruler of the earth, from the Rock of the desert to the mountain of the daughter of Zion.
Enviád cordero al enseñoreador de la tierra, desde la Piedra del desierto al monte de la hija de Sión.
2 And this shall be: like a bird fleeing away, and like fledglings flying from the nest, so will the daughters of Moab be at the passage of Arnon.
Y será como ave espantada, que se huye de su nido, así serán las hijas de Moab a los vados de Arnón.
3 Form a plan. Call a council. Let your shadow be as if it were night, even at midday. Conceal the fugitives, and do not betray the wanderers.
Toma consejo, haz juicio: pon tu sombra en el mediodía como la noche: esconde los desterrados, no descubras al huido.
4 My fugitives will live with you. Become a hiding place, O Moab, from the face of the destroyer. For the dust is at its end; the miserable one has been consumed. He who trampled the earth has failed.
Moren en ti mis desterrados, o! Moab: séles escondedero de la presencia del destruidor; porque el chupador fenecerá, el destruidor tendrá fin, el hollador será consumido de sobre la tierra.
5 And a throne will be prepared in mercy, and One shall sit upon it in truth, in the tabernacle of David, judging and seeking judgment, and quickly repaying what is just.
Y componerse ha trono en misericordia; y asentarse ha sobre él en firmeza en el tabernáculo de David quien juzgue, y busque el juicio, y apresure la justicia.
6 We have heard of the pride of Moab; he is very proud. His pride and his arrogance and his indignation is more than his strength.
Oído hemos la soberbia de Moab, soberbio mucho: su soberbia, y su arrogancia, y su altivez: mas sus mentiras no serán firmes.
7 For this reason, Moab will wail to Moab; each one will wail. Speak of their wounds to those who rejoice upon the brick walls.
Por tanto aullará Moab, todo él aullará: gemiréis por los fundamentos de Kir-jareset, empero heridos.
8 For the suburbs of Heshbon are deserted, and the lords of the Gentiles have cut down the vineyard of Sibmah. Its vines have arrived even at Jazer. They have wandered in the desert. Its seedlings have been abandoned. They have crossed over the sea.
Porque las vides de Jesebón fueron taladas, y las vides de Sibma: señores de naciones hollaron sus generosos sarmientos que habían llegado hasta Jazer: habían cundido hasta el desierto: sus nobles plantas se extendieron, pasaron la mar.
9 I will weep with the tears of Jazer over this, the vineyard of Sibmah. I will inebriate you with my tears, Heshbon and Elealeh! For the sound of those who trample has rushed over your vintage and over your harvest.
Por lo cual lamentaré con lloro a Jazer de la viña de Sibma: embriagarte he de mis lágrimas, o! Jesebón, y Eleale; porque sobre tus cosechas, y sobre tu segada caerá la canción.
10 And so, rejoicing and exultation will be taken away from Carmel, and there will be no jubilation or exultation in the vineyards. He who was accustomed to tread will not tread out the wine in the winepress. I have taken away the sound of those who tread.
Quitado es el gozo y la alegría del campo fértil: en las viñas no cantarán, ni jubilarán: no pisará vino en los lagares el pisador: la canción hice cesar.
11 Over this, my heart will resonate like a harp for Moab, and my inner most being for the brick wall.
Por tanto mis entrañas sonarán como arpa sobre Moab; y mis intestinos sobre Kir-jareset.
12 And this shall be: when it is seen that Moab has struggled upon his high places, he will enter his holy places to pray, but he will not prevail.
Y acaecerá que cuando Moab pareciere que está cansado sobre los altos, entonces vendrá a su santuario a orar, y no podrá.
13 This is the word that the Lord has spoken to Moab concerning that time.
Esta es la palabra que pronunció Jehová sobre Moab desde aquel tiempo.
14 And now the Lord has spoken, saying: In three years, like the years of a hired hand, the glory of Moab concerning the entire multitude of the people will be taken away, and what is left behind will be small and weak and not so numerous.
Empero ahora habló Jehová, diciendo: Dentro de tres años, como años de mozo de soldada, será abatida la gloria de Moab con toda su multitud, aunque grande; y sus residuos serán pocos, pequeños, no fuertes.
